NetTcpRelayBinding Konstruktoren
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Überlädt
NetTcpRelayBinding() |
Initialisiert eine neue Instanz der NetTcpRelayBinding-Klasse. |
NetTcpRelayBinding(String) |
Initialisiert einen neuen instance der NetTcpRelayBinding -Klasse mit einer angegebenen XML-Konfiguration. |
NetTcpRelayBinding(EndToEndSecurityMode, RelayClientAuthenticationType) |
Initialisiert eine neue instance der NetTcpRelayBinding -Klasse mit dem typ der verwendeten Sicherheit und der angegebenen Relayclientauthentifizierung. |
NetTcpRelayBinding(EndToEndSecurityMode, RelayClientAuthenticationType, Boolean) |
Initialisiert eine neue instance der NetTcpRelayBinding -Klasse mit dem verwendeten Sicherheitstyp, dem Typ der Clientauthentifizierung und einem Wert, der angibt, ob zuverlässige Sitzungen explizit aktiviert sind. |
NetTcpRelayBinding(TcpRelayTransportBindingElement, BinaryMessageEncodingBindingElement, ReliableSessionBindingElement, NetTcpRelaySecurity) |
Initialisiert eine neue instance der NetTcpRelayBinding -Klasse mit dem angegebenen Transport, Encoder, zuverlässigen Sitzungsbindungselement und sicherheitstyp. |
NetTcpRelayBinding()
Initialisiert eine neue Instanz der NetTcpRelayBinding-Klasse.
public NetTcpRelayBinding ();
Public Sub New ()
Gilt für:
NetTcpRelayBinding(String)
Initialisiert einen neuen instance der NetTcpRelayBinding -Klasse mit einer angegebenen XML-Konfiguration.
public NetTcpRelayBinding (string configurationName);
new Microsoft.ServiceBus.NetTcpRelayBinding : string -> Microsoft.ServiceBus.NetTcpRelayBinding
Public Sub New (configurationName As String)
Parameter
- configurationName
- String
Die zu verwendende Konfiguration.
Gilt für:
NetTcpRelayBinding(EndToEndSecurityMode, RelayClientAuthenticationType)
Initialisiert eine neue instance der NetTcpRelayBinding -Klasse mit dem typ der verwendeten Sicherheit und der angegebenen Relayclientauthentifizierung.
public NetTcpRelayBinding (Microsoft.ServiceBus.EndToEndSecurityMode securityMode, Microsoft.ServiceBus.RelayClientAuthenticationType relayClientAuthenticationType);
new Microsoft.ServiceBus.NetTcpRelayBinding : Microsoft.ServiceBus.EndToEndSecurityMode * Microsoft.ServiceBus.RelayClientAuthenticationType -> Microsoft.ServiceBus.NetTcpRelayBinding
Public Sub New (securityMode As EndToEndSecurityMode, relayClientAuthenticationType As RelayClientAuthenticationType)
Parameter
- securityMode
- EndToEndSecurityMode
Der Sicherheitstyp, der mit dieser Bindung verwendet wird.
- relayClientAuthenticationType
- RelayClientAuthenticationType
Der Typ der Clientauthentifizierung, die auf dem Relay verwendet wird.
Gilt für:
NetTcpRelayBinding(EndToEndSecurityMode, RelayClientAuthenticationType, Boolean)
Initialisiert eine neue instance der NetTcpRelayBinding -Klasse mit dem verwendeten Sicherheitstyp, dem Typ der Clientauthentifizierung und einem Wert, der angibt, ob zuverlässige Sitzungen explizit aktiviert sind.
public NetTcpRelayBinding (Microsoft.ServiceBus.EndToEndSecurityMode securityMode, Microsoft.ServiceBus.RelayClientAuthenticationType relayClientAuthenticationType, bool reliableSessionEnabled);
new Microsoft.ServiceBus.NetTcpRelayBinding : Microsoft.ServiceBus.EndToEndSecurityMode * Microsoft.ServiceBus.RelayClientAuthenticationType * bool -> Microsoft.ServiceBus.NetTcpRelayBinding
Public Sub New (securityMode As EndToEndSecurityMode, relayClientAuthenticationType As RelayClientAuthenticationType, reliableSessionEnabled As Boolean)
Parameter
- securityMode
- EndToEndSecurityMode
Der Typ der Sicherheit, die mit der Azure Service Bus-Bindung verwendet wird.
- relayClientAuthenticationType
- RelayClientAuthenticationType
Der Typ der Clientauthentifizierung, die auf dem Relay verwendet wird.
- reliableSessionEnabled
- Boolean
true, wenn zuverlässige Sitzungen aktiviert sind, andernfalls false.
Gilt für:
NetTcpRelayBinding(TcpRelayTransportBindingElement, BinaryMessageEncodingBindingElement, ReliableSessionBindingElement, NetTcpRelaySecurity)
Initialisiert eine neue instance der NetTcpRelayBinding -Klasse mit dem angegebenen Transport, Encoder, zuverlässigen Sitzungsbindungselement und sicherheitstyp.
protected NetTcpRelayBinding (Microsoft.ServiceBus.TcpRelayTransportBindingElement transport, System.ServiceModel.Channels.BinaryMessageEncodingBindingElement encoding, System.ServiceModel.Channels.ReliableSessionBindingElement session, Microsoft.ServiceBus.NetTcpRelaySecurity security);
new Microsoft.ServiceBus.NetTcpRelayBinding : Microsoft.ServiceBus.TcpRelayTransportBindingElement * System.ServiceModel.Channels.BinaryMessageEncodingBindingElement * System.ServiceModel.Channels.ReliableSessionBindingElement * Microsoft.ServiceBus.NetTcpRelaySecurity -> Microsoft.ServiceBus.NetTcpRelayBinding
Protected Sub New (transport As TcpRelayTransportBindingElement, encoding As BinaryMessageEncodingBindingElement, session As ReliableSessionBindingElement, security As NetTcpRelaySecurity)
Parameter
- transport
- TcpRelayTransportBindingElement
Das zu verwendende Transportbindungselement.
- encoding
- BinaryMessageEncodingBindingElement
Die zu verwendende Codierung.
- session
- ReliableSessionBindingElement
Das zuverlässige Sitzungsbindungselement.
- security
- NetTcpRelaySecurity
Das Sicherheitsbindungselement.
Gilt für:
Azure SDK for .NET